1. What Is Highly Reactive Polyisobutylene (HR-PIB)?
Highly Reactive Polyisobutylene (HR-PIB) is a synthetic polymer derived from isobutylene, characterized by its high level of terminal double bonds. These reactive sites make it an ideal feedstock for manufacturing additives and intermediates used in lubricants, fuel additives, adhesives, and sealants.
Key Properties of HR-PIB:
High reactivity due to vinylidene content (85–90%)
Excellent viscosity and flexibility
Superior thermal and oxidative stability
Good compatibility with a wide range of industrial chemicals
Because of these characteristics, HR-PIB plays an indispensable role in enhancing product performance across multiple sectors.
2. Why Is HR-PIB So Important in the Lubricants Industry?
One of the primary growth drivers of the HR-PIB market is its application in lubricant formulations. HR-PIB is used to produce polyisobutylene succinimide dispersants, which serve a critical function in keeping engines clean and enhancing fuel economy.
Benefits of HR-PIB in Lubricants:
Prevents sludge and carbon deposit formation
Improves engine cleanliness and efficiency
Enhances fuel economy
Reduces wear and tear on engine components
Ensures better emission control
As automotive technology evolves toward high-performance and fuel-efficient engines, the demand for premium lubricants containing HR-PIB continues to surge, especially in emerging markets with growing vehicle production.

4. Beyond Lubricants: Expanding Industrial and Chemical Applications
While lubricants dominate HR-PIB consumption, diversification of applications is driving additional growth avenues.
4.1 Adhesives and Sealants
HR-PIB is a preferred raw material in pressure-sensitive adhesives (PSAs) and industrial sealants due to its tackiness, elasticity, and moisture resistance.
Provides excellent bonding strength
Ensures long-term flexibility in high-stress environments
Enhances durability and chemical resistance
These properties make HR-PIB ideal for construction, automotive, and packaging sectors.
4.2 Industrial and Specialty Chemicals
In the chemical industry, HR-PIB acts as a building block for specialty intermediates used in manufacturing various polymer-modified products, offering performance enhancement in coatings, insulation, and cable compounds.
4.3 Fuel Additives
HR-PIB is utilized in fuel formulations to produce detergent-dispersant additives that keep engines clean, reduce corrosion, and improve combustion efficiency.
